DWRG is an independent rambling & hill walking group aimed at young people in their 30's and 40's. We want to encourage everyone into the joys of walking and you can become a member of this club for just £5 per annum entitling you to come on any of our walks (for which we make no extra charge)

We hold:

Sunday Walks  full day walks in walks in Surrey, Sussex, Kent, Hampshire and occasionally further afield. Mostly between 8 & 12 miles in length.  Some are "figures of eight", making it easy to walk just the morning or the afternoon. We always stop for a few beers and a pub lunch. Group size averages 15 people.

Weekend / Bank Holiday Trips Away  for coastal, moorland and mountain walking, using a variety of accommodation. Group size averages 20 people.

Friday Evening Walks  from May to early September, we hold a short (2-4) mile walk to a country pub.

Social Events  including meals out, theatre, music & barbecues, all in welcoming and friendly company.
